Transaction 703384707acd93b1bde02a56a6131dd282ba0d3ba3ec87cb5847f754aa53de1d
1 Input
1 Output
-
703384707acd93b1bde02a56a6131dd282ba0d3ba3ec87cb5847f754aa53de1d:0
- value
- 6243239
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c4dd28544bf588c2f19fd4d54ac449c90c6f941 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KdG5KqddJeZVxEbdU4c7xHYM4sbA2kwh7